Tips For Creating Mahogany Color Palettes

Designing with mahogany can be both rewarding and challenging, but with the right approach, you can create stunning visuals.

  • Balance with Neutrals: Pair mahogany with neutral colors like beige, cream, or gray to create a balanced and harmonious look.
  • Complementary Shades: Use complementary colors such as teal or navy blue to make the mahogany pop and add visual interest.
  • Accent with Metallics: Incorporate metallic accents like gold or bronze to enhance the richness of mahogany and add a touch of luxury.
  • Layering Tones: Experiment with different shades of mahogany and other warm tones to create depth and dimension in your design.
  • Versatile Combinations: Mix mahogany with both warm and cool colors to create versatile designs that can adapt to various themes and settings.

How to Use Mahogany Patterns in Design

In home decor, mahogany color palettes can create a warm and inviting atmosphere. Use mahogany tones for accent walls or furniture pieces to add depth and sophistication to any room. Pair these rich hues with neutral colors like beige or cream to maintain a balanced and harmonious look.

For marketing materials, mahogany palettes can convey a sense of luxury and reliability. Incorporate these tones in your branding to evoke a timeless elegance that resonates with your audience. Use complementary colors like teal or navy blue to make your designs pop and capture attention.

In clothing design, mahogany hues can add a touch of classic elegance. Use these rich tones for statement pieces or accessories to create a sophisticated and cohesive look. Pair with metallic accents like gold or bronze to enhance the overall aesthetic.
